Emirates Cabin Crew Requirements. At least 21 years old. A natural team player with a personality that shines. Arm reach of 212 cm while standing on tiptoes. At least 160 cm tall. High school graduate (grade 12) Fluency in English (written and spoken) No visible tattoos while in Emirates cabin crew uniform.

Cabin Crew at Emirates start off with a yearly salary of AED 124,656 ($33,943 USD). Senior crew can earn up to $48,000 USD per year. Salary is tax-free and covers basic salary, flight hours, and layover payments. Emirates also offers free housing with bills included.
